Thirukkural- On Virtue- Compassion-Kural-245
Compassion
oi-Staff
By Staff

This kural could be rendered in English thus, following K Srinivasan's effort:
The vast and flourishing wind-blown earth is witness to the fact,That those who practise compassion will never be subjected to suffering.
There is no further need to labour the point of this couplet, which only emphasises the idea of the previous two Kurals by stating that the good earth itself will bear testimony to the fact that no harm will come to a man who practices compassion.
